Analysis
The most recent figure for secondary education, general pupils, per capita in Bolivia, Plurinational State of is 0.0387 units per person, measured in 2018.
That represents a change of up 0.4% on the previous year and down 9.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, secondary education, general pupils, per capita in Bolivia, Plurinational State of peaked at 0.0923 units per person in 1999 and was at its lowest, 0.0316 units per person, in 1970.
That places Bolivia, Plurinational State of 196th out of 204 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 35 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
Secondary education, general pupils div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Secondary education, general pupils 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Secondary education, general pupils Stat Bulk Data Download Service, UN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organization (UNESCO)
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
